The Glue Gun Evolution: From Craft Rooms to Grid-Scale Storage
Modern automatic adhesive dispensing systems have come further than your average glue stick. Today’s solutions include:
- UV-curing "instant bond" systems faster than a viral TikTok trend
- Thermally conductive adhesives that handle heat better than a professional chef
- Self-healing polymers that repair themselves like Wolverine

The Future’s So Bright (We Need Strong Adhesive)
As the energy storage market grows to $490 billion by 2030 [1], glue application systems face their biggest test yet. Next-gen challenges include:
- Bonding solid-state battery components without creating stress fractures
- Adhesives that withstand lunar temperature swings for space-based solar
- Instant-cure systems for field repairs on offshore wind farms
